DADU: A man killed his two young nephews over a property dispute in Sindh’s Dadu district, here on Monday.

According to the police, a fight broke out between uncle and nephews over a land dispute in Imam Bakhsh Bhand village of Dadu district. Two young nephews Mukhtar Ali and Muhammad Hanif Bhand lost their lives during the shooting.

As soon as the incident was reported, the police reached the spot and seized the bodies and shifted them to DHQ Hospital, Dadu, where the bodies were handed over to the next of kin after post-mortem and legal proceedings.

Police say that a case has been registered in the incident, investigations are on. However, the accused have escaped from their homes, and raids are being conducted to arrest them.
